Project: Infidel
I don't know why, but I like the idea of creating my own "Infidel Edition K5"
Here's the plan as I stand today. I bought a pair and a half of 71 K5's. 1 has a nice suspension (stock but 0 rust issues) ... and nice glass. 1 has a great tub and dual walled top. Since the guy wouldn't just sell the parts I wanted, I ended up with 3 full sets of doors, fenders, hoods, suspensions, ... a lot of goodies! I'm going to mix and match to get a solid foundation of a beast and then go bed liner from firewall to tail gate (inside and underside). Although both have 350's with trans and etc. I'm going to put a '95 police interceptor edition 350 w/ 4speed + od trans in it. Then sand out any rough spots and paint Sand (OD HumVee paint) as it is great at hiding scuffs and dings ~ not to mention durable as ^*&(^& Though, I'm hoping to sell off some of the extras to finance some of the work. But with all the extra parts, I'm sure I'll make out like a bandit in the end. As I trim down the pic's, I'll post the process as I go. |
